#b5ca29 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b5ca29 is composed of 71% red, 79.2%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.7%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 67.8 degrees, a saturation of 66.3% and a lightness of 47.6%. #b5ca29 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ff52 with #6b9500.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#b5ca29 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b5ca29 has RGB values of R:181, G:202,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 11913769.
